The “Telecom Italia” yacht, piloted by the duo Giovanni Soldini and Karinne Fauconnier, became the winner of the Les Sables/Horta/Les Sables regatta, winning the two stages of this international competition for 40-feet sailing boats.
This sailing boat, which was built in 2007, crossed the finishing line at 1:41:32 AM (France local time), having taken 6 days, 5 hours and 32 seconds to travel the distance between the Horta port, on Faial Island, and the Les Sables d’Olonne port, located on the French Atlantic Coast.
In this second stage, the “CG Mer” yacht, piloted by Wilfrid Clerton and Loic Lehelley, took second place and the “Tzu-Hang” yacht, piloted by Axel Strauss and Juerg Burger arrived in third.
Only 4 of the 24 yachts that have left Horta towards France last Wednesday, to take part in the second stage, have concluded the competition until the present moment.
With a total distance of 2,540 nautical miles, the Les Sables/Horta/Les Sables regatta, which will return to the Azores in 2011, is considered as one the most important nautical competitions that has ever taken place in Portugal.
This year’s edition was organised in France by the municipality of Les Sables d’Olonne, under the coordination of the Institut Sports Océan (Ocean Sports Institute) and the Class 40 association, with the support of the Regional Council of the Pays-de-la-Loire, the General Council of the Department of Vendée, the Olona Port, the TV Channel France Ouest and of Aout-Web Informatique.
The event was organised in the Azores by the Horta Nautical and the Municipal Commission (an entity that congregates the Horta City Hall, the Clube da Naval da Horta, the Administration of the Port of the Triangle and of the Western Group – APTO and the Regional Sailing Association of the Azores – ARVA/VelAçores), counting upon the support of the Azorean Government, the municipal company Hortaludus, Peter Café Sport,JM – Transportes and Demolições and of TerAuto.
